Network Time Protocol daemon (version 4)
The Network Time Protocol (NTP) is used to synchronize the time of a
computer client or server to another server or reference time source,
such as a radio, satellite receiver, or modem.
Ntpd is an operating system daemon that sets and maintains the system
time-of-day synchronized with Internet standard time servers.
